Output f79f1348feaa4c152a42612a11bdd53b93bb75558d71adf56482aac0f2d5e351:1

value
25000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6780de75924f07bf9515798b51eb8c2d54e210ef OP_EQUAL
address
3B8HuGy3AK6vESBokF332Z5NvoqZMSzHHi
transaction
f79f1348feaa4c152a42612a11bdd53b93bb75558d71adf56482aac0f2d5e351
confirmations
451866
spent
true